Monika Grzymala - Drawing Spatially. Vortex.
Monika Grzymala’s „spatial drawing“ unfolds in three dimensions, as an installation made of four kilometers of black tape. It is direct, concise and coherent like an aphorism. Minimal maxims are phrased with a sense for absurdity – an intuitive kind of thinking where everything is possible. It seems to be the intention to extract a parallel logic from reality, in order to establish hypotheses in a desperate quest to find answers to the great existential questions. This accumulative work attains unity by excess, creating an unlimited universe of connotations.
With the exhibition "Drawing Now" an extensive overview of drawing as a medium, with 36 artists of the younger generation is on display in the Albertina until October 11th 2015.
